Although unnecessary <code>using</code> won't change anything to the produced application, removing them:
* Will help readability and maintenance.
* Will help reduce the number of items in the IDE auto-completion list when coding.
* May avoid some name collisions.
* May improve compilation time because the compiler has fewer namespaces to look-up when it resolves types.
* The build will fail if this namespace is removed from the project.
== Noncompliant Code Example
----
using System.Collections.Generic; // Noncompliant - unnecessary using
namespace Foo
{
public class Bar
{
public Bar(string path)
{
File.ReadAllLines(path);
}
}
}
----
== Compliant Solution
----
using System.IO;
namespace Foo
{
public class Bar
{
public Bar(string path)
{
File.ReadAllLines(path);
}
}
}
----
